Какие-нибудь контрольные показатели по сравнению с JDK8 ConcurrentHashMap и базовой версией JDK7?
В слайде "ConcurrentCachingAtGoogle" упоминается реализация JDK8 ConcurrentHashMap
больше не использовать сегментированную хэш-таблицу.
Я предполагаю, что "сегменты" - это разделение верхнего уровня, которое использовала старая реализация.
Что делает новая реализация и как она работает относительно JDK7, когда дело доходит до увеличения таблицы?
Кроме того, любая информация о том, какие факторы (помимо объема памяти в пустых экземплярах) привели к изменениям, будет приветствоваться.